jira chart macro is displaying broken issue avatars - how to resolve?

Michael Blake September 3, 2018

We are using confluence 6.6.1 and jira 7.6.0.  The jira chart macro is attempting to reference the issue type avatars with http connection(disabled) instead of https connection.  How do we get the macro to display the issue type avatars correctly in Confluence?

Hello Michael, it might be that the application link between Confluence and Jira was created when Jira was on HTTP.
Could you try removing the Application link between Confluence and Jira, from both ends, Confluence and Jira, and try recreating them.

Once that is done, try flushing the cache from the Confluence cache management site as well.

  • (ConfluenceBaseURL)/admin/cache/showStatistics.action

If the links still redirect to HTTP, we should try clearing the plugin cache once, and see if there's any difference.
